Course details
• Cross-Cultural Communication: Understanding and navigating cultural differences in a professional setting.
• Global Diversity and Inclusion Strategies: Developing and implementing effective strategies to promote diversity and inclusion in a global workforce.
• Managing Diversity in the Global Workplace: Techniques for managing and leveraging diversity to create a positive and productive work environment.
• Legal and Ethical Considerations in Global Diversity: Understanding the legal and ethical implications of diversity and inclusion practices in a global context.
• Diversity Training and Development: Creating and delivering diversity training programs to educate and sensitize employees to diversity and inclusion issues.
• Diversity Metrics and Analytics: Measuring and tracking diversity and inclusion efforts to ensure effectiveness and progress.
• Global Mobility and Cultural Adaptation: Helping employees adjust to new cultural environments and promoting cultural competence in global assignments.
• Inclusive Leadership: Developing leadership skills to effectively manage and lead a diverse workforce.
• Global Talent Management: Strategies for attracting, developing, and retaining a diverse global talent pool.
